Innovative Lighting Ideas for Every Room
Kitchen Lighting Solutions
Your kitchen is often the heart of your mobile home and deserves special attention. When considering a Northern Nevada mobile home kitchen remodel, think about these lighting ideas:
Layered Lighting: Combine ambient, task, and accent lighting. Install pendant lights above islands or tables for focused task lighting while incorporating recessed LED lights for overall brightness.
Under-Cabinet Lighting: This is a game changer for day-to-day kitchen tasks. Installing LED strip lights underneath cabinets brightens up your work surfaces.
Statement Fixtures: Choose a stunning chandelier or a unique light fixture that acts as a focal point while providing essential light. This not only enhances functionality but elevates the overall aesthetic.
Bathroom Brightness
The bathroom is another critical area where proper lighting is essential. During your mobile home bathroom remodel, incorporate the following lighting strategies:
Vanity Lighting: Install sconces or a lighted mirror at eye level for flattering light that helps with grooming tasks.
Layering Fixtures: Use a combination of overhead lighting and accent lights to provide a well-lit but soothing atmosphere.
Accent Lighting: Consider adding accent lighting to niches or around mirrors to create a spa-like ambiance.
Living Room and Bedroom Lighting
Your living room and bedrooms should feel inviting and relaxing. Here are some tips for these spaces:
Soft Lighting: Replace harsh overhead lights with soft, warm options like floor lamps or table lamps to create a cozy atmosphere.
Dimmer Switches: Install dimmer switches to adjust the mood depending on the time of day or occasion.
Decorative Fixtures: Choose decorative light fixtures that match your style. Unique lampshades or artistic ceiling fixtures can be conversation starters.
Exploring Energy-Efficient Options
In your quest for effective lighting, remember the importance of energy-efficiency. Not only can this reduce your utility bills, but it can also minimize the ecological footprint of your mobile home upgrade.
LED Bulbs: Opt for LED bulbs, as they use significantly less energy than traditional bulbs and last much longer.
Smart Lighting: Consider smart bulbs that can be controlled via smartphone apps. You can change color and brightness based on your needs or preferences.
Maximize Natural Light: Use light colors for your window treatments, and avoid obstructing windows where possible to let the sunlight bless your home.
Integrating Technology for Modern Homes
Incorporating smart technology into your mobile home lighting is a modern and efficient way to elevate your space. Here are a few tech-savvy suggestions:
Smart Switches: These allow users to control lighting remotely or set schedules, making it easier to manage energy use and convenience.
Voice Control: Integrate your lights with voice-activated tools such as Google Assistant or Amazon Alexa for hands-free help.
Sensors: Use motion sensors in areas like hallways and bathrooms to automatically illuminate when someone enters.

Navigating Mobile Home Insurance Claims for Lighting Damage
It’s essential to be mindful of how lighting and electrical features may impact your mobile home insurance. If you encounter issues like lighting damage due to storms or electrical faults, knowledge of mobile home insurance claims can be invaluable. Documenting new lighting installations and improvements can help you in these claims should the need arise.
Make sure to keep records of all upgrades, including receipts and photos of your freshly remodeled lighting installations. In the event of an accident or damage, your insurer may require this documentation during the claims process.
